Warning Signs You Need Hardwood Floor Water Damage Repair

Ignoring warning signs can lead to bigger problems and costly repairs down the line. Here are some common signs that you need hardwood floor water damage repair: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Strong, persistent odors can be a sign that your hardwood floor is damaged and needs professional attention. Don’t ignore these odors; they can show a moisture problem that’s creating an environment for mold and mildew to grow.

Warped or Buckled Boards

Warped or buckled boards can be a sign that your hardwood floor is damaged and needs repair. These boards can be re-surfaced or replaced, depending on the extent of the damage.

Stains or Discoloration

Unexplained stains or discoloration on your hardwood floor can be a sign that it’s damaged and needs professional attention. Our technicians can assess the damage and recommend the best course of action.

Soft or Spongy Spots

Soft or spongy spots on your hardwood floor can be a sign that it’s damaged and needs repair. These spots can be caused by excess moisture or wear and tear.

Hardwood Floor Water Damage Repair v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Water damage is extensive, covering multiple rooms. No Yes DIY efforts can’t keep up with the scale of the damage.
Water damage is localized, but the hardwood floor is severely warped. No Yes DIY repairs may not be enough to fix the damage.
Water damage is minor, and the hardwood floor is only slightly affected. Yes No DIY repairs may be enough to fix the damage.
The hardwood floor is old and valuable, and you want to preserve its original condition. No Yes DIY repairs may damage the floor further and compromise its value.
You’re unsure about how to proceed with the repairs or the extent of the damage. No Yes Calling a professional ensures that the job is done correctly and safely.

Hardwood Floor Water Damage Repair Cost in Waseca, MN

The cost of hardwood floor water damage repair in Waseca, MN can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our estimates are based on the severity and size of the damage, but the actual cost may be higher or lower.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water Extraction $500 – $2,500 The severity and size of the damage, as well as the amount of water extracted.
Drying and Moisture Control $1,000 – $5,000 The size and complexity of the job, as well as the amount of moisture present.
Restoration $2,000 – $10,000 The extent of the damage, the type of finish needed, and the labor required.
Final Inspection and Touch-ups $500 – $2,000 The extent of the damage and the amount of labor required for the final inspection and touch-ups.

Can I prevent water damage from occurring in the first place?

Yes, there are steps you can take to prevent water damage from occurring in the first place. Regular maintenance, such as checking your sump pump and inspecting your roof and gutters, can help prevent water damage. Also, installing a water sensor or alarm can alert you to potential water damage.
